This position is in-office and located in Myrtle Beach, SC.

Job Summary The Branch Coordinator coordinates information flow and oversees loan-level activities and administrative processes associated with the mortgage lending function for the branch and its subdivisions. The Branch Coordinator is a liaison with the Builder and the Mortgage Operations team.

Primary

Job Responsibilities Provides visibility into the loan backlog for builder partners and title operations.

Provides all required and requested information and documents to Operations partners upon request.

Communicate effectively with Operations partners to manage backlog for the branch within the Area, ensuring loans track along the homebuilding process appropriately.

Manages and maintain data integrity for closing dates and closing methods.

Completes all month-end reporting for branch and builder partners and completes any ad-hoc reports upon request.

Supports Branch Mortgage Financing Advisors when needed with administrative tasks.

Maintains all branch matrices and subdivision setups.

Maintains all branch tools as needed.

Manages Project Approval processes, as needed.

Assists with marketing efforts.

Supports branch teams plan goals.

Performs other duties as assigned.

Required Education/Experience Minimum High School Diploma or equivalent

Prior administrative experience a plus Required Skills/Knowledge Ability to build relationships with business partners quickly, and then leverage those relationships to achieve key performance objectives.

Effective verbal and written skills to communicate actionable and valuable information to various dependent parties at different levels of the organization in a clear, effective, and professional manner.

Ability to manage multiple competing priorities at the same time and make sound business judgments about shifting those priorities.

Ability to be detail-oriented and have a passion for data accuracy and integrity.

Ability to prioritize and follow up with internal stakeholders
